Faith Works is a non profit organization based in Goa that reaches out to over 500,000 listeners of all faiths in Goa, through FM Rainbow's Good Morning Lord & Argam Tuka Somia.

29th Oct'07 was the 172nd episode of Good Morning Lord and in the same week later is the 94th episode of Argam Tuka Somia. In fact, Good Morning Lord is the longest running sponsored program in the history of Goa radio.

Of all the music that reaches heaven, nothing compares to the beating of a truly loving heart. Faith Works has conducted two Gospel Musical Concerts earlier this year at the Kala Academy & and at the Don Bosco's grounds.

The first Thank God It's Tuesday held at the Kala Academy on 17thApril'07 was a great success. The place was packed right till the very end. There were over 2500 people, priests & nuns. Fr. Loiola Pereira, Secretary to the Archbishop of Goa opened the program with a prayer followed by a soul stirring song. Two Goan Gospel Bands - 'All 4 Jesus' and 'God's Love In Harmony' performed followed by a 17- piece Gospel Band - 'Vigil Lights' from Mumbai that led the people into praise & worship through music. India's leading saxaphonist Braz Gonsalves gave his testimony and performed as well.

'Thank God it's Tuesday-II' was staged on 15th May'07 for the Glory of God and all who attended, went back with love, peace & joy in their hearts. It was a joy to experience the electrifying atmosphere at Don Bosco's grounds. The whole scene of the green football grounds, the many volunteers sporting orange & blue 'Thank God It's Tuesday' t-shirts, the enormous stage; the awesome sound suspended high above the ground and the musicians who led the people right into the presence of the King. Glen & Theresa LaRive from the Divine Centre, Kerala performed along with Fr. Nixon D'Silva sfx (Pilar Fathers); Merwyn Caldeira and the local Gospel Band from Panjim - All 4 Jesus performed.
